     17 package benchmarks.regression;
     18 
     19 import com.android.org.bouncycastle.crypto.Digest;
     20 import com.google.caliper.BeforeExperiment;
     21 import com.google.caliper.Param;
     22 
     23 public class DigestBenchmark {
     24 
     25     private static final int DATA_SIZE = 8192;
     26     private static final byte[] DATA = new byte[DATA_SIZE];
     27     static {
     28         for (int i = 0; i < DATA_SIZE; i++) {
     29             DATA[i] = (byte)i;
     30         }
     31     }
     32 
     33     @Param private Algorithm algorithm;
     34 
     35     public enum Algorithm { MD5, SHA1, SHA256,  SHA384, SHA512 };
     36 
     37     @Param private Implementation implementation;
     38 
     39     public enum Implementation { OPENSSL, BOUNCYCASTLE };
     40 
     41     private Class<? extends Digest> digestClass;
     42 
     43     @BeforeExperiment
     44     protected void setUp() throws Exception {
     45         String className = "com.android.org.bouncycastle.crypto.digests.";
     46         switch (implementation) {
     47             case OPENSSL:
     48                 className += ("OpenSSLDigest$" + algorithm);
     49                 break;
     50             case BOUNCYCASTLE:
     51                 className += (algorithm + "Digest");
     52                 break;
     53             default:
     54                 throw new RuntimeException(implementation.toString());
     55         }
     56         this.digestClass = (Class<? extends Digest>)Class.forName(className);
     57     }
     58 
     59     public void time(int reps) throws Exception {
     60         for (int i = 0; i < reps; ++i) {
     61             Digest digest = digestClass.newInstance();
     62             digest.update(DATA, 0, DATA_SIZE);
     63             digest.doFinal(new byte[digest.getDigestSize()], 0);
     64         }
     65     }
     66 }
